Pediatrician Nimali Fernando and feeding therapist Melanie Potock (aka Dr. Yum and Coach Mel) know the importance of giving your child the right start on his or her food journey - for good health, motor skills, and even cognitive and emotional development.
In this thoroughly updated, second edition of Raising a Healthy, Happy Eater they explain how to expand
your family s food horizons, avoid the picky eater trap, identify special feeding needs, and put joy back into mealtimes, with:
Advice tailored to every stage from newborn through school-age
Real-life stories of parents and kids whom the authors have helped
Wisdom from cultures across the globe on how to feed kids
Helpful insights on the sensory system, difficult mealtime behaviors, and everything from baby-led weaning to sippy cups
Seven passport stamps for good parenting: for being joyful, compassionate, brave, patient, consistent, proactive, and mindful.
Raising a Healthy, Happy Eater shows the way to lead your baby, toddler, or young child on the path to adventurous eating. Grab your passport and go!
About the Author
Melanie Potock, MA, CCC-SLP, is an international speaker to teens on the topic of feeding babies. Melanie has coached over a thousand parents on how to raise healthy, happy eaters right from the start and has over twenty years of clinical experience helping children with pediatric feeding disorders. She is the coauthor of the award-winning Raising a Healthy, Happy Eater and author of Adventures in Veggieland and Responsive Feeding (forthcoming). Melanie s advice has been shared in a variety of television and print media, including The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al, Washington Post, CNN.com, and Parents magazine. She lives in Colorado.
